Wood a key plank in the business case for bringing nature into the office

Employers looking to boost worker productivity should consider using more of one of the world’s oldest and most sustainable materials in their office fit-outs: wood.

That’s the takeout from world-first research by strategic market research firm Pollinate and the University of Canberra.
